Skip to content
Home
Contact
USA
Blog
Contact Our Expert
Navigation Menu
Home
Contact
USA
Blog
Intellitech Inc in Pompano Beach, FL 33062
Intellitech Inc
3242 Ne 13th St
(954) 786-5335
Call Now Button